【计算机开题报告】兰亭序图书管理系统

一、论文题目

选题方向–兰亭序图书管理系统的设计与实现 题目来源
自拟?公司委托?网络外包单?……

二、选题的来源和意义

1、来源

现如今,互联网的广泛普及与应用,标志着信息化的时代已经到来,管理信息化行业在生活中占据着越来越重要的地位,信息化的服务与管理,大大简化了传统的管理模式,很大程度上,改善了使得人们的生活水平和工作方式。简单的来说图书管理信息化的形式非常简单,操作方便快捷,相关的工作人员可直接在网上进行管理,管控也不需要受时间和空间的限制,随时随地皆可在网上完成管理。现在,随着互联网的普及与应用,管理信息化被广大使用者所认可,并且非常喜爱这样的方式管理图书信息,使得网上管理变得越来越流行,实用价值极高,故而本人研发了兰亭序图书管理系统。

2、意义

互联网使得我们的工作和生活发生了巨大的改变,全球经济一体化促进了管理信息化的发展,与此同时,管理信息化也促进了经济一体化的发展。从某种程度上来说,我们的生活越来越离不开互联网,与此同时,管理信息化行业也所占据也越来越重要的地位。本系统为用户提供了一个界面友好、使用简单的管理平台,使得图书信息管理不再受到时间和空间的限制,随时随地可以进行管控,具有很重要的价值和意义。通过这次的毕业设计,使得我在原来学习的专业知识基础上,提高了实践动手操作能力,在不断的实践中提高自己的能力。本课题的设计实用价值很高,它是我们将所学专业知识应用于实践中的实例,增加了我们的实际动手操作能力,提高了我们的专业水平和技能。

三、选题的开发背景

1、选题的国内、外研究概况和趋势

互联网使得我们的工作和生活发生了巨大的改变,全球经济一体化促进了管理信息化的发展,与此同时,管理信息化也促进了经济一体化的发展。早在20世纪80年代,美国就已经开始发展电子商务行业,良好的经济,完备的技术和稳定的社会条件,为管理信息化行业的发展提供了一种很好的发展氛围。1999年,为了每一个需要的用户都实现上网,欧盟委员会制定了电子欧洲计划。许多企业在其应用程序中加入了网上信息化管理的模式,它的形式新颖,具有个性化设计,多样化服务,上升空间极大,有利于提高相关行业的工作效率和管理质量。
管理信息化行业具有较强的发展趋势,它是一股崭新的力量,正在不断地推动国家经济增长。物流安全、网络安全、用户信息安全等相关问题都得到了大大的改善,基本上很少出现这些人们所担心的问题。网络中的资源多,种类齐全,可对比性强,这为用户提供了极大的便捷。相比于国外,我国管理信息化出现的比较晚,但是相关的技术人员不断的发展与完善计算机技术,使得网络市场得到了空前的发展,吸引着越来越多的人们接受和使用,促进着管理信息化行业不断的发展,并且正逐渐与国外减少差距。马云在二十一世纪初,大力使用互联网技术,创办了支付宝、淘宝,在到后来唯品会、京东等电子商务平台,以及饿了么、美团等美食外卖平台的出现,标志着我国的电子商务正在逐渐走向成熟,也在另一方面证明着网络技术的发展使得我们的管理信息化行业水平达到了顶峰。

2、选题内容要解决的问题

(1)兰亭序图书管理系统需要具有什么样的功能。
(2)使用哪些开发工具,对系统进行设计。
(3)系统有效性和稳定性如何得到保障。

四、课题内容以及实施方案

1.课题内容(设计任务)

本系统预期设计的主要功能有注册登录管理、用户信息管理、图书借阅管理、图书归还管理等模块。注册登录管理:首次使用本系统的用户,需要进行注册操作,完成注册操作后,用户登录本系统,即可实现访问功能。系统使用者角色分为管理员角色和用户角色,通过登录操作,选择相应的角色,输入对应的账号、密码,登录成功后,即可使用本系统。通过密码信息管理功能模块,用户可以对个人账号的登录密码进行修改操作,定时更新个人登录密码,进而保障个人密码信息的安全。通过用户信息管理功能模块,相关使用者可以对用户信息进行管理,比如可以选择修改、删除某位用户,也可以选择增加、查询用户信息。通过图书借阅管理功能模块,相关使用者可以对图书借阅信息进行管理,也可以选择修改、删除某条图书借阅信息,也可以选择增加、查询某条图书借阅信息。通过图书归还管理功能模块,相关使用者可以对相关的图书归还信息进行管理,比如可以选择修改、删除某条资料记录信息,也可以选择增加、查询某条图书归还信息。

2.实施方案(用什么方法如何实现设计任务)

兰亭序图书管理系统对安全性、实用性以及时间等方面的要求是非常高的,并且信誉评级方面需要严控和完善,这是一个极其严峻的挑战。为了适应和满足各种需求,本人以设计与实现兰亭序图书管理系统为目的,查询大量的信息化管理系统资料,根据问卷调查等相关方法,对比市场中的主流开发模式,分析用户的需求,部署与开发相关问题的系统结构,设计系统运行模式和总体方案,使用Java语言、SSM框架、MySQL数据库等关键技术和工具,并使用MySQL搭建完备的数据库,存储与管理相关数据信息,详细设计系统的主要功能,最后对页面、功能模块设计等方面进程测试。在进行大量的功能测试的过程中,所设计的系统能满足用户的使用需求,并且出错率很低、并发性强、安全性高,即可将其投入使用。

3.预期成果 (课题结束将有哪些成品)

(1)一款兰亭序图书管理系统
(2)一篇10000字以上的毕业论文

五、论文的基本框架

设计和实现兰亭序图书管理系统,总体的工作安排有:
第一部分绪论,主要介绍所研究课题的背景和意义,国内外现状以及研究的主要内容;
第二部分相关技术概述,主要阐述在开发兰亭序图书管理系统的过程中,所使用的Java语言、SSM框架、MySQL数据库等关键技术和基本理论;
第三部分系统分析,通过对系统进行需求分析和可行性分析得出,设计本系统是具备实用价值与意义的,并提出体系的总体设计;
第四部分数据库设计,针对于数据库做详细的设计,设计相关的数据表格和实体-联系图,存储和管理相关的数据信息;
第五部分系统实现,根据前几章的关键技术与工具,详细设计系统功能模块,然后细化和实现每个功能模块中的子结构设计,完成数据库的搭建工作,实现满足用户使用要求系统功能设计;
第六部分系统测试,对上一章所实现的系统功能模块进行测试,根据测试过程中遇到的问题,对系统进行改进与完善;
第七部分总结与展望,主要总结本系统的设计与实现工作,改进其中的不足之处,并对未来工作做进一步的展望。

六、系统开发环境

硬件环境:Windows10笔记本电脑一台
软件环境:在idea开发平台上,使用Java语言编码设计系统功能模块,SSM框架创建项目主流架构,MySQL数据库设计系统相关二点数据表格,存储和管理数据信息的数据仓库。
通过使用关键技术研发本系统,并根据需求分析得出用户的主要需求,设计与实现本系统的功能模块。再通过系统测试,主要是功能测试,对系统进行纠错和改进,完善系统的不足之处,使得最后设计出的系统更能够符合使用者的需求。

七. 课题开发进度

第1~2周 查询相关资料,确定课题,设计研究方案。
第3~4周 结合课题要求,分析课题,提交开题报告。
第5~8周 完成并提交系统需求分析、总体设计和详细设计。
第9~12周 实现系统编码、调试及软件测试,并撰写毕业论文。
第13~14周 修改毕业论文至定稿,资格审查。
第15~16周 毕业设计答辩。

八、主要参考文献

[1]Paul Krill. Microsoft publishes Java roadmap for Visual Studio Code[J]. InfoWorld.com,2022.
[2]MagmaMC is a Minecraft Survival Server with both Java and Bedrock support[J]. M2 Presswire,2022.
[3]李艳杰.基于JAVA与MySQL数据库的移动端题库练习系统的设计与实现[J].黑龙江科学,2022,13(02):56-57.
[4]王茹葳.Java编程语言在大数据开发中的应用[J].电子技术,2022,51(01):160-161.
[5]孙辉中.JAVA编程语言在计算机软件开发中的应用[J].网络安全技术与应用,2022(01):49-50.
[6]李少芳.Java消除类游戏设计的实现技术[J].普洱学院学报,2021,37(06):28-30.
[7]林辉.基于Java Web的渭南市大荔县图书管理系统的设计与实现[J].电子设计工程,2021,29(24):155-158+163.
[8]张烈超,胡迎九.典型Java Web开发框架模型的研究[J].武汉交通职业学院学报,2021,23(04):122-127.
[9]李晶晶.新视角下的JavaScript课程教学研究[J].软件,2021,42(12):31-33+82.
[10]胡素娟.基于Java图书管理系统的设计与实现[J].信息记录材料,2021,22(12):161-163.

  • 9
    点赞
  • 12
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

写JAVA代码的人

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值